How to fertilize Melocactus azureus ferreophilus
Most potting soils come with ample nutrients which plants use to produce new growth.
By the time your plant has depleted the nutrients in its soil itās likely grown enough to need a larger pot anyway.
To replenish this plant's nutrients, repot your Melocactus azureus ferreophilus after it doubles in size or once a yearāwhichever comes first.
